Stuart explores all of the issues above in a completely open and raw manner that does not sensationalise or trivialise.
The book captures life in Glasgow during the 80’s exceptionally and whilst some may struggle with the language used it is, within the limits of fictional writing, accurate.
I would recommend this book to anyone and believe I will be thinking about it for a long time to come, but for most it will be worth reading the trigger warnings prior.

Young Mungo is set Glasgow and follows Mungo as he explores his sexuality and identity. Giving a voice to teenagers during a time where violence, social class, family and queerness were different.
Heartbreaking story and graphic at times but the story was amazing and breaths life into an overlooked point of view.
